Electronics Maintenance & Repair Schools in Iowa

27 Electronics Repair students earned their degrees in the state in 2021-2022.

In terms of popularity, Electronics Maintenance & Repair is the 26th most popular major in the state out of a total 36 majors commonly available.

Jobs for Electronics Maintenance & Repair Grads in Iowa

In this state, there are 7,260 people employed in jobs related to an electronics repair degree, compared to 851,880 nationwide.

undefined

Wages for Electronics Maintenance & Repair Jobs in Iowa

Electronics Repair grads earn an average of $43,560 in the state and $44,710 nationwide.

Electronics Maintenance & Repair Careers in IA

Some of the careers electronics repair majors go into include:

Job Title IA Job Growth IA Median Salary
Semiconductor Processors 33% $0
Security and Fire Alarm Systems Installers 18% $49,790
Radio, Cellular, and Tower Equipment Installers and Repairs 14% $0
Electric Motor, and Power Tool Repairers 14% $43,720
Electronic Home Entertainment Equipment Installers and Repairers 9% $38,240
Telecommunications Line Installers and Repairers 7% $51,520
Industrial Equipment Electrical and Electronics Repairers 6% $58,220
Installation, Maintenance, and Repair Workers 6% $43,980
Home Appliance Repairers 5% $38,840
Computer, Automated Teller, and Office Machine Repairers 2% $38,300
Telecommunications Equipment Installers and Repairers -5% $51,940
